R&D projects co-financed by the EC |
GESTCO |
| "Geological storage of CO2 from fossil fuel combustion" ? a completed 5th Framework Programme project assessed the potential for geological storage of CO2 in 8 ?old EU? countries. |
 |
CAPRICE |
| FP6 project on international cooperation and exchange in the area of post-combustion CO2-capture using amine processes |
 |
CO2STORE |
| A completed 5th Framework Programme (FP5) project, focused on storage of CO2 in aquifers, incl. 4 case studies. |
 |
RECOPOL |
| A completed 5th Framework Programme (FP5) project, concentrated on storage of CO2 in coal seams. |
 |
NASCENT |
| "Natural analogues for the storage of CO2 in the geological environment" - a completed 5th Framework Programme project, focused on research on natural CO2 occurrences. |
 |
EU GeoCapacity |
| "Assessing European Capacity for Geological Storage of Carbon Dioxide" ? 6th Framework Programme (FP6) project embraces also EU New Member States and Candidate Countries. |
 |
CO2SINK |
| FP6 Integrated Project, dedicated to CO2 storage in a saline aquifer near Ketzin in Germany. |
 |
ENCAP |
| "Enhanced capture of CO2" - FP6 Integrated Project focused on pre-combustion capture of CO2. |
 |
CASTOR |
| "CO2 from capture to storage" - FP6 Integrated Project mainly concentrated on post-combustion capture of CO2. |
 |
CACHET |
| FP6 Integrated Project focused on development of technologies for technologies to reduce greenhouse gas emissions from power production from natural gas with coincident hydrogen production. |
 |
ISCC |
| "Innovative In Situ CO2 Capture Technology for Solid Fuel Gasification" ? 6th Framework Programme project. |
 |
HY2SEPS |
| "Hybrid Hydrogen - Carbon Dioxide Separation Systems" ? FP6 project devoted to development of hybrid membranes for H2 and CO2 separation for fossil fuels decarbonisation process used for the pre-combustion CO2 capture. |
 |
Dynamis |
| "Towards Hydrogen and Electricity Production with Carbon Dioxide Capture and Storage" ? FP6 project, part of the HYPOGEN initiative, the goal of which is to put the first European full-scale facility for combined hydrogen & power production from fossil fuels into operation by 2015. |
 |
Accsept |
| "Acceptance of CO2 capture and storage, economics, policy and technology" ? FP6 project focused on main obstacles to implementation of CO2 capture and storage technologies in Europe. |
 |
NANOGLOWA |
| "Optimal nanostructured membranes and installations for CO2 capture from power plants" - an FP6 project focused on research on nanostructured membranes for CO2 capture and separation. |
